In this text, the author tracks the history of American copyright law through the 20th century, from Mark Twain's exhortations for 'thick' copyright protection, to recent lawsuits regarding sampling in rap music and the 'digital moment', exemplified by the rise of Napster and MP3 technology.Vaidhyanathan, Siva is the author of 'Copyrights and Copywrongs The Rise of Intellectual Property and How It Threatens Creativity', published 2003 under ISBN 9780814788073 and ISBN 0814788076.
